The inverse problem, concerning the reconstruction of the three following inhomogeneous properties of a bar is considered: Young modulus, shear modulus and density using amplitude-frequency characteristics of steady-state longitudinal, bending and torsion vibrations of the bar. To identify unknown properties of the material, iteration processes based on the apparatus of Fredholm integral equations of the first and the second kinds are constructed. Some aspects of numerical implementation and the results of numerical experiments are discussed.
